Abstract
The utility model discloses a vacuum ball valve, which comprises a valve body, a valve rod and a valve ball, wherein a mounting hole is formed in the valve body, a sealing sleeve is fixedly and hermetically connected to the mounting hole, the valve rod is rotatably mounted in the sealing sleeve, a round hole is formed in the top of the valve ball, a first sealing ring is arranged between the round hole and the sealing sleeve, a second sealing ring is arranged between the lower end of the sealing sleeve and the lower end of the valve rod, a sealing filler assembly is arranged between the upper end of the sealing sleeve and the upper end of the valve rod, a key groove is formed in the center of the round hole, and the key groove is in key connection with a key block arranged on the lower end face of the valve rod. According to the utility model, the sealing sleeve which is fixedly connected with the valve body in a sealing way is arranged outside the valve rod, and the sealing ring is arranged between the valve rod and the valve ball, so that the tightness between the valve rod and the valve body is improved, the valve can bear larger pressure without leakage of the valve rod and the sealing sleeve, and the service life of a product is prolonged.

Background
The vacuum ball valve is a ball valve which has working pressure lower than standard atmospheric pressure, is sealed by a ball surface, can be used in a vacuum state and a low-pressure state and can be installed at any position. The vacuum ball valve is generally connected to a foreline or rough evacuation system of the vacuum apparatus, and can be used for conveying gas or liquid medium, or can be used as a release valve. The vacuum ball valve is widely used in petroleum, chemical industry, mine, construction, instrument and meter manufacturing industry, has good performance of being not easy to leak and being capable of accurately controlling flow. When the valve rod is operated, the sealing ring arranged between the valve rod and the valve body is easy to wear, so that the tightness is damaged, the vacuum ball valve is leaked when the pressure difference is overlarge, and the service life of the vacuum ball valve is shortened.

Detailed Description
The utility model is further described below with reference to the accompanying drawings:
Referring to fig. 1-2: the vacuum ball valve comprises a valve body 1, a valve rod 2 and a valve ball 3, wherein a mounting hole 4 is formed in the valve body 1, a sealing sleeve 5 is fixedly and hermetically connected to the mounting hole 4, the valve rod 2 is rotationally mounted in the sealing sleeve 5, a round hole 6 is formed in the top of the valve ball 3, a first sealing ring 7 is arranged between the round hole 6 and the sealing sleeve 5, a second sealing ring 8 is arranged between the lower end of the sealing sleeve 5 and the lower end of the valve rod 2, a sealing filler assembly is arranged between the upper end of the sealing sleeve 5 and the upper end of the valve rod 2, a key groove 9 is formed in the center of the round hole 6, and the key groove 9 is in key connection with a key block 10 arranged on the lower end face of the valve rod 2. When the valve rod 2 rotates relative to the sealing sleeve 5, the valve ball 3 can be driven to rotate in the valve body 1 through the cooperation of the key block 10 and the key groove 9, so that the opening and closing functions of the valve are realized. The sealing sleeve 5 can reduce the corrosion of the medium to the valve rod 1, the first sealing ring 7 and the second sealing ring 8 play a double sealing role, the medium in the valve body 1 can be prevented from leaking from reaching a gap between the valve rod 2 and the sealing sleeve 5, the pressure of the medium leakage can be reduced by larger sliding fit between the valve rod 2 and the sealing sleeve 5, the sealing filler assembly can play a role in more effective sealing, and the leakage prevention capability of the valve is improved.
The round hole 6 and the sealing sleeve 5 are respectively provided with a first annular groove 11 and a second annular groove 12, a first sealing ring 7 is fixedly installed between the first annular groove 11 and the second annular groove 12, and a V-shaped annular groove 13 is arranged on the upper side of the first sealing ring 7, so that the deformation of the first sealing ring 7 can be conveniently installed. The lower end of the sealing sleeve 5 is provided with a third annular groove 14 for installing the second sealing ring 8, and a thrust bearing 15 is arranged between the third annular groove 14 and the second sealing ring 8. The thrust bearing 15 serves to reduce the frictional resistance to relative rotation between the seal sleeves 5. The sealing packing assembly comprises a pressing cover 16, a packing body 17 and an elastic corrugated sleeve 18, wherein the pressing cover 16 is in threaded connection with the sealing sleeve 5, the packing body 17 is arranged below the pressing cover 16, and the elastic corrugated sleeve 18 is arranged inside the packing body 17. The gland 16 can squeeze the packing body 17 to realize sealing when being screwed up, and the elastic corrugated sleeve 18 can store energy when being compressed and deformed, and then elastic force is generated to act on the packing body 17, so that the sealing performance and the service life of the packing body 17 are improved.
